Minneapolis / St. Cloud area recommendations

Heading down to Minneapolis/St. Cloud area for a short week away in Sept. Would like recommendations for 30' travel trailer without kids just pets so don't need playground, etc.

Trying to look at RV park reviews, etc. but only seem to be older reviews in that area. Most of the reviews I have found have been northern MN.

  • Baker Park Reserve which is located about 16 miles west of Minneapolis. It is a very nice park with large sites and several miles of walking/biking paths.Clicky
  • We stay at Lake Elmo Park Reserve : http://www.co.washington.mn.us/index.aspx?NID=502 It's excellent and is kind of like what Birds Hill Park is for Winnipeg. It's just outside the Minneapolis/St. Paul bypass on the east side of the city. It's like camping in the country, but the city is close at hand.
    Rate is $25/day Mon.to Thru.& includes park pass and $28/day weekends & includes park pass. RV Park reviews : http://www.rvparkreviews.com/regions/minnesota/lake-elmo/lake-elmo-park-reserve. And they rate it at 9.4/10.
  • There is a very nice county park, Lebanon Hills. It's not far from the interstate and is on the south eastern part of the Twin Cities metro area - Apple valley/Eagan area.

    Not sure which area of the Twin Cities you are looking into, but it's not bad to get across town from.

    This park, they generally have a minimum stay for Holiday weekends. So watch the weekend of Sept 5/6/7, may have a minimum stay requirement.
  • We had a short project in Minneapolis/St Paul. There weren't many RV Parks in that area, so we stayed at a MH Park in Bloomington, near jobsite.

    But we did drive to the Mystic Lake Casino and the Dakotah Meadows RVPark was right onsite. It was huge, well maintained, but not sure how kids would enjoy it.
